GOOD! I was hoping you would say that! Don't buy terminals, get some bolts, nuts, and some ring terminals and you are set. Drill two holes in your box, one for (+) and one for (-), make sure your bolts are just small enough to fit in the holes, attach a ring terminal on the outside, one on the inside, and put the nut on. You are set, you can put some silicone around it if you are worried about air leaks.

i bought (2) 5/16 2 inch long brass bolts, there more conductive than steel, but im sure steel will still work.

it was 10 dollars, just for a nice piece of mind. worth it!
